219. The Cold War did not start with the Berlin Airlift with Giles Milton


Listen Later

In this episode of History Rage, host Paul Bavill is joined by historian and author Giles Milton to explore the chaotic aftermath of WWII, focusing on the often overlooked post-war period and its critical role in shaping modern geopolitics.


The Forgotten Years

Giles argues that the immediate post-war period is often overshadowed by the Second World War itself. He emphasizes how understanding this era is crucial for grasping modern conflicts, including the motivations behind Putin’s actions today.


Berlin: The Epicentre of ConflictDivided City

The discussion delves into the division of Berlin after 1945, where the Allies' failure to fully capture the city allowed Stalin to solidify his control and loot its treasures.


Propaganda and Power

Giles reveals the story behind the iconic photo of the Red Flag over the Reichstag, showcasing how it served as a potent propaganda tool for the Soviets.


The Breakdown of Alliances

As tensions rise, the personal relationships between the Big Three Allied leaders deteriorate. Giles shares insights into Operation Unthinkable, Churchill’s secret plan to confront the Soviets, and the growing mistrust among the leaders.


The Berlin Airlift

The episode wraps up with the Berlin Airlift of 1948, often mischaracterized as the Cold War’s beginning. Giles explains the significance of the Airlift, a logistical marvel that kept 2.5 million Berliners alive amidst the Soviet blockade, and why the Cold War’s roots stretch back to 1945.
